Is Echinacea Angustifolia Leaf Extract safe in cosmetics?
Echinacea Angustifolia Leaf Extract has a safety rating of "GOOD" in our database. EU status: permitted. US status: permitted.
INCI: ECHINACEA ANGUSTIFOLIA LEAF EXTRACT
Echinacea Angustifolia Leaf Extract (CAS 84696-11-7 (EINECS 283-631-6; CosIng Ref 33750)) is a cosmetic cosmetic ingredient functioning as Skin conditioning, anti-inflammatory, wound healing support.
